[C+Opengl+Linux]pb à l'execution - C++ - Programmation
Marsh Posté le 21-10-2002 à 21:07:01
c'est une blague ce post.....????
comment veux tu lancer un truc opengl sur une carte qui le gere pas...
y en a qui ont de droles d'idees des fois.
si je pouvais jouer a quake avec ma cirrus pci 1mo, j'aurais pas achete une gf2...
Marsh Posté le 21-10-2002 à 21:13:49
le truc c ke je lance lexe a l'aide de vnc où la sur la machine cliente il y a une carte qui gere l'opengl mais je sais pas trop si ca peut fonctionner.
aussi cette erreur n'est ptet pas lier à la carte graphique.
Marsh Posté le 21-10-2002 à 21:25:37
chuis pas sur que bosser par vnc soit une tres bonne idee pour developper un jeu....
t'as quoi comme distri / carte /drivers sur ta machine cliente ?
Marsh Posté le 21-10-2002 à 21:38:53
sur ma machine clientet c windobe mais je ne pretend pas au developpement d'un jeu mais pou l'instant il s'agit juste d'apprendre les bases de l'opengl.
Marsh Posté le 21-10-2002 à 22:05:47
bon en gros, c'est quoi ton environement de developement ??
disti, carte, drivers, etc...
Marsh Posté le 21-10-2002 à 22:44:59
c la debian 3.0, sur un athlon500 avec une carte SiS 86C326. Les drivers de la carte sont ceux de base fournis avec la debian pour les cartes SiS. Et donc j'utilise vnc et kde2 pour ce qui est de l'interface graphique. Sinon j'ai installé mesa 3.42 et glut 3.7 (j'ai eu de nombreux problèmes a compilé le peu de code que j'ai pour afficher le rectangle de couleur : a cause de libglut.so qui n'était pas le bon) .
Marsh Posté le 22-10-2002 à 00:41:17
ben en fait mesa c'est vraiment pas le top en opengl...
trouves plutot n'importe quel nvidia de la tnt a la geforce4 et installes leur pilotes.
Marsh Posté le 21-10-2002 à 20:55:02
je compile un fichier d'essai (l'affichage d'un carré tout simple) avec les commande :
gcc ogl1.c -o ogl -L/usr/X11R6/lib -lGL -lGLU -lglut -lX11 -Xmu -lXi -lm
ca compile sans probleme mais lorsque j'execute le fichier j'ai le droit à l'erreur :
./ogl: relocation error: /usr/lib/libglut.so.3: undefined symbol: glXQueryExtension
est-ce que ca peut venir du fait que ma carte graphique est une carte qui ne gere pas l'opengl?